郭天祥数码管动态扫描显示课件_第1页
郭天祥数码管动态扫描显示课件_第2页
郭天祥数码管动态扫描显示课件_第3页
郭天祥数码管动态扫描显示课件_第4页
郭天祥数码管动态扫描显示课件_第5页
已阅读5页,还剩20页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

郭天祥数码管动态扫描显示课件CATALOGUE目录数码管动态扫描显示原理郭天祥数码管动态扫描显示程序郭天祥数码管动态扫描显示实验郭天祥数码管动态扫描显示应用总结与展望数码管动态扫描显示原理01七段数码管和八段数码管是最常见的数码管类型,它们由多个LED段组成,可以显示数字和部分字母。数码管种类数码管的工作电压一般在5伏左右,通过电流的大小可以控制数码管的亮度。工作电压通过给数码管的各个段施加相应的电压,可以点亮或熄灭相应的段,从而显示不同的数字或字母。显示原理数码管工作原理动态扫描显示是通过逐行扫描的方式,依次点亮数码管的各个段,以实现多位数码管的显示。逐行扫描刷新频率节省IO口为了使数码管显示稳定,需要保证一定的刷新频率,即每秒钟扫描的次数。通过动态扫描显示,可以同时显示多位数码管,而只需要较少的IO口资源。030201动态扫描显示原理

数码管接口电路限流电阻为了保护数码管和驱动电路,需要在数码管和驱动电路之间串联一个限流电阻。驱动电路常见的驱动电路有晶体管驱动和集成电路驱动,它们可以将微弱的控制信号放大,以驱动数码管正常工作。编码方式为了控制数码管的各个段,需要采用合适的编码方式,如BCD码、余3码等。郭天祥数码管动态扫描显示程序02本程序流程图展示了数码管动态扫描显示的实现过程,包括初始化、主循环和显示更新等步骤。流程图概述在程序开始时,需要对数码管进行初始化设置,包括设置数码管的位选信号、段选信号以及显示数据等。初始化步骤程序进入主循环后,会不断更新数码管的显示数据,通过动态扫描的方式逐一点亮每个数码管,实现动态显示效果。主循环步骤在主循环中,每次更新数码管显示数据时,需要逐位点亮数码管,并刷新显示数据,以确保显示的正确性和稳定性。显示更新步骤程序流程图代码结构初始化函数主循环函数显示更新函数程序代码解析01020304本程序主要由初始化函数、主循环函数和显示更新函数等组成。用于设置数码管的位选信号、段选信号以及显示数据等参数。程序的主执行流程,负责不断更新数码管的显示数据。负责逐位点亮数码管并刷新显示数据,以确保显示的正确性和稳定性。运行环境本程序适用于模拟单片机环境,通过仿真器或调试器运行。显示效果程序运行后,数码管将按照设定的动态扫描方式逐一点亮,实现动态显示效果。用户可以通过调整程序中的参数来改变数码管的显示内容、扫描速度等。程序运行效果郭天祥数码管动态扫描显示实验03步骤一:硬件连接连接数码管到单片机:将数码管的阳极连接到单片机的一个端口上,将数码管的阴极连接到另一个端口上。实验步骤步骤二:编写程序步骤三:编译程序实验步骤将程序编译成可执行文件。步骤四:下载程序将可执行文件下载到单片机中。实验步骤步骤五:运行程序给单片机上电,观察数码管是否正常显示。实验步骤实验结果分析结果一:数码管正常显示如果数码管能够正常显示数字或字符,说明实验成功。结果二:数码管显示异常结果三:程序编译错误如果程序无法编译,可能是由于语法错误或编译器设置不正确等原因引起的。如果数码管显示异常,可能是由于硬件连接问题、程序编写错误或单片机故障等原因引起的。在连接数码管时,要注意不要短路,以免损坏数码管或单片机。在编写程序时,要注意合理使用延时函数,以保证数码管显示的稳定性和准确性。在进行实验时,要确保电源稳定,避免因电源波动对实验结果造成影响。注意事项一:安全问题注意事项二:编程技巧注意事项三:实验环境010203040506实验注意事项郭天祥数码管动态扫描显示应用04应用场景在各种电子设备上显示时间,如手机、平板电脑等。在汽车、飞机等交通工具的仪表盘上显示速度、里程等信息。在商场、车站等公共场所展示广告信息。在智能家居设备上显示温度、湿度等信息。电子时钟电子仪表广告牌智能家居动态扫描显示技术能够有效地降低功耗,延长设备的续航时间。高效节能数码管动态扫描显示能够实现多位数字或字符的同时显示,且显示效果清晰、稳定。显示效果好数码管动态扫描显示技术结构简单,维护方便,成本低廉。易于维护数码管动态扫描显示技术适用于各种需要进行数字显示的场合。应用广泛应用优势应用案例分析电子时钟应用案例在智能手表上实现实时时间的动态扫描显示,用户可以随时查看当前时间,且时间显示清晰、准确。广告牌应用案例在商场门口的广告牌上实现动态扫描显示,展示各种促销信息,吸引顾客的注意力,提高商品的销售量。电子仪表应用案例在汽车仪表盘上实现车速、里程等信息的动态扫描显示,使驾驶员能够随时了解车辆的运行状态,提高驾驶安全性。智能家居应用案例在家用智能温度计上实现温度的动态扫描显示,用户可以随时查看室内温度,并根据温度调整空调等设备的运行状态,提高居住舒适度。总结与展望05总结数码管动态扫描显示技术原理详细介绍了数码管动态扫描显示的基本原理,包括硬件电路设计和软件编程实现。课件内容与结构总结了课件的内容,包括数码管显示原理、硬件电路设计、软件编程实现等章节,以及各章节之间的逻辑关系和整体结构。教学方法与技巧分析了课件所采用的教学方法与技巧,包括理论讲解、实例演示、实践操作等,以及这些方法对提高教学效果的作用。教学效果评估对课件的教学效果进行了评估,包括学生对数码管动态扫描显示技术的掌握程度、实际应用能力等,以及与其它同类课程的比较。展望数码管显示技术的发展趋势,包括新型显示技术的出现和应用,以及未来可能的发展方向。技术发展趋势探讨了数码管动态扫描显示技术与其它相关学科的交叉融合,以及如何通过学科交叉来促进技术创新和应用发展

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论